Manchester City are ‘hopeful’ striker Sergio Aguero will be fit for their season opener against Wolves after making a fast recovery from knee surgery just three months ago.

The star frontman was expected to miss the start of the 2020-21 campaign after going under the knife in late June.

The report claims Aguero is now pain free and his mobility is improving which has given City confidence he will be available to feature in the Molineux face-off.

The north-west club will be thankful their season kicks off a week later than most teams after they and Manchester United were granted extra time off due to their European exploits last season.

Their season came to an end only three weeks ago when they were eliminated from the Champions League at the quarter-final stage after a 3-1 defeat against Lyon.

Aguero was absent for the disappointing defeat and Guardiola will be hoping he can keep the 32-year-old fit for as much of the season as he can.

The prolific forward scored 23 times in just 32 appearances last season and is the club’s all-time highest goalscorer.with a staggering 254 goals.

City will be desperate to wrestle their Premier League crown back off Liverpool this campaign after finishing 18 points behind the Reds in the last campaign.
